Physical activity in hospitalised stroke patients

Summary
Hospitalized stroke patients spend most of their day inactive and alone. Further research is needed to understand and improve physical activity levels after stroke.

Background:
- Stroke is a leading cause of long-term disability.
- Hospitalization following stroke presents a critical period for recovery and rehabilitation.
- Understanding physical activity patterns during hospitalization is crucial for optimizing patient outcomes.
Purpose of the Study:
- To systematically review and quantify the amount and type of physical activity in hospitalized stroke patients.
- To identify factors associated with physical activity levels in this population.
Main Methods:
- Systematic literature review of observational studies.
- Inclusion of 24 studies utilizing behavioral mapping, video recording, and therapist reports.
- Analysis of patient activity, location, and therapy session duration.
Main Results:
- Hospitalized stroke patients are predominantly inactive (median 48.1%) and spend most time alone (median 53.7%) and in their bedrooms (median 56.5%).
- Limited time is allocated to moderate to high physical activity, even during physiotherapy (median 63.2 min) and occupational therapy (median 57.0 min).
- Lower physical activity levels are observed in patients within 14 days post-stroke and those receiving conventional care.
Conclusions:
- Physical activity levels are significantly low among hospitalized stroke survivors.
- Enhanced methods for describing and classifying post-stroke physical activity are needed to facilitate data pooling.
- Further investigation into the benefits of increased physical activity and the efficacy of interventions post-stroke is warranted.
